Analysis
In 2024, tomatoes — gross production value in European Union (27) stood at 12.01 million 1000 USD.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 4.1% on the previous year and up 1.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, tomatoes — gross production value in European Union (27) peaked at 14.50 million 1000 USD in 2004 and was at its lowest, 5.12 million 1000 USD, in 1961.
That places European Union (27) 5th out of 29 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 64 years of available data.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
